Recycled Integrated Circuits Detection

This paper delves into the critical realm of electronics and semiconductor technology, focusing on the detection of recycled integrated circuits. The increasing prevalence of counterfeit and repurposed electronic components in the market poses significant threats to both consumer safety and the integrity of various industries, including aerospace, automotive, and electronics manufacturing.

Our research paper explores the techniques employed to identify recycled integrated circuits, with a primary emphasis on assessing the reliability and accuracy of these methods. By evaluating the strengths and weaknesses of various detection approaches, this study aims to contribute valuable insights to the fields of electronics authentication and quality control. We examine the trade-offs between different techniques and propose recommendations to enhance the detection of recycled integrated circuits, ultimately safeguarding the reliability and functionality of electronic systems.
